Profiel - fkootstra.nl Freek Kootstra v20151101...  · Web viewRuim 15 jaar werkzaam in de ICT....

7

Click here to load reader

Transcript of Profiel - fkootstra.nl Freek Kootstra v20151101...  · Web viewRuim 15 jaar werkzaam in de ICT....

Page 1: Profiel - fkootstra.nl Freek Kootstra v20151101...  · Web viewRuim 15 jaar werkzaam in de ICT. Vooral ontwikkelen van administratieve software. Mijn interesse gaat uit naar software-architectuur

Curriculum Vitae Freek Kootstra

Personalia

Naam Freek KootstraWoonplaatsEmail

[email protected]

Telefoonnummer 06 53 54 38 14

Profiel/ kenmerken

Bezoek ook mijn Linkedin profiel voor de laatste updates en extra informatie.

Ruim 15 jaar werkzaam in de ICT. Vooral ontwikkelen van administratieve software. Mijn interesse gaat uit naar software-architectuur in een complexe technische omgeving en het ontwerpen van professionele software aan de hand van functionele en technische specificaties. Interfacing met andere pakketten via back-end en middle-tier componenten. Beheren van SQLServer databases en het genereren van rapportages hieruit voor andere software-pakketten en statistische analyses. Door de diverse werkzaamheden en omgevingen van de afgelopen jaren ben ik breed inzetbaar en flexibel. Ik heb veel kennis van en ervaring met financiele software, administraties, goederenhandel en risico analyse.

Analytisch Nauwkeurig Consentieus Vlotte werker Humor Doorzettingsvermogen

Vakkennis

Branches Rol/ functie ICT Software engineer Mobiele Telefonie Software architect Goederenhandel Administratieve software

Tools Databases UML Xtreme & Agile development SQLServer 6.5/2005/2008R2/2012/SqlAzure Software Quality Assurance Analysis Server SSAS OO(P)/Reverse engineering Reporting Server SSRS Cyclic development Subversion / SVN versie controle Scrum ORM Platform IoT / M2M Windows Servers DevOps Windows Azure

Methoden, technieken VisualBasic 6 Transact-SQL C# + ASP.Net XML/XSL/XPATH Javascript/Ajax Regular Expressions Crystal Reports

1 / 6 versie: mei 2023

Page 2: Profiel - fkootstra.nl Freek Kootstra v20151101...  · Web viewRuim 15 jaar werkzaam in de ICT. Vooral ontwikkelen van administratieve software. Mijn interesse gaat uit naar software-architectuur

Curriculum Vitae Freek Kootstra

Opleiding / trainingen

AlgemeenPraedinius Gymnasium GroningenRijksuniversiteit Groningen, arts examen

ICT gerelateerd1997 Visual Basic 5.02003 DotNet Architecture2006 Updating your database-skills to SQLServer20052007 Certificering Implementing & Maintaining

SQLServer2005

2007 Business Intelligence for SQLServer20052008 Certificering Exact Globe 2003 Enterprise

2012 Windows Azure for Developers

2015 Cursus Diving in OOP via CodeProjectCursus Stairway to MDX queries via SqlServerCentral

Talen

Nederlands Duits Engels

Vroegere werkgevers

Sedert 2009 Freek Kootstra ICT als freelance professional2008-2009 Down To Earth ICT2007-2008 Exact Software Delft2000-2007 InfospaceMobile, Papendrecht1999-2000 Witchcraft IT Services, Rotterdam1998-1999 HANDS B.V., Rotterdam

Ervaring overzicht:

08/2015 - 12/2015 SqlServer/C# developerLukkienLukkien is een bedrijf dat onder andere IT oplossingen levert voor klanten

Samen met een college een al gedeeltelijk gebouwde E-commerce website voor het boeken van vakantiereizen afmaken. Security opzetten, database connecties optimalizeren. Data overzetten vanuit een ooude MySql database. De website is gebouwd met MVC 4.5 en WCF 4.0 als framework.Scrum als werkmethode.

Gebruikte technologie: WCF, MVC, Linq, Json, Razor, AjaxVisualStudio2013, TFS, SqlServer 2014

2 / 6 versie: mei 2023

Page 3: Profiel - fkootstra.nl Freek Kootstra v20151101...  · Web viewRuim 15 jaar werkzaam in de ICT. Vooral ontwikkelen van administratieve software. Mijn interesse gaat uit naar software-architectuur

Curriculum Vitae Freek Kootstra

12/2014 - 05/2015 Software DeveloperFreek Kootstra ICT.

Een oude speelgoed autobaan verbinden met de Cloud via een Arduino minicomputer.De Arduino verbindt met een Windows Azure service die een AI module bevat. Het doel hiervan is om de modelautootjes te kunnen besturen zodat ze in de bochten langzamer rijden en niet tegen elkaar botsen.Afbeeldingen en een uitgebreide omschrijving van het project:http://www.dataspider.nl/modelcartrack.htmHet doet ook mee in de Microsoft Azure IoT Contest van Codeproject:http://www.codeproject.com/Articles/887003/Control-a-model-car-track-with-Azure-and-ArduinoInmiddels is de tweede fase van het project succesvol afgerond.

Gebruikte technologie:C/C++ for the ArduinoC# for the Cloud serviceVisualStudio 2012, Windows Azure, SqlServer Azure

03/2014 – 01/2015 Billing engineer en SqlServer developerTeleena

Teleena is een mobile services provider (MVNE) gebaseerd in het VK en Nederland.

Schrijven en aanpassen van scripts en queries voor het facturatie platform. Hierbij gebruik gemaakt van PowerShell, SSIS packages en SSRS rapportages. Aanpassen van C# code in CLR assemblies en SSIS scripts. Maken en aanpassen van unit-tests en andere test harnassen in samenwerking met de testers. Schrijven en aanpassen van de custom code voor retail facturatie van mobiele telefoon eindgebruikers (meer dan 100.000 facturen per maand). Refactoring van het bestaande platform voor toename van het volume en voor data consolidatie. Gewerkt met Scrum in een klein team van ontwikkelaars en testers.

Gebruikte software: VisualStudio2008/SqlServer2008R2 64bit, VisualStudio 2012,SSRS, SSIS, Powershell

Operating systeem : Windows 2008R2 Server

12/2013 - 12/2013 VBA and Sql DeveloperNebest Adviesgroep.

MS-Word sjabloon aangepast om data direct uit een Sqlserver database op te halen ipv. handmatig in te voeren. ReportServer rapportages aangepast om een andere dataformaat te verwerken.

Gebruikte software: MS-Office 2007/Sqlserver 2008R2/SSRSOperating systeem : Windows2008R2 Server

02/2013 - 05/2013 SqlServer BI developerANWB TravelANWB Travel is part of the Dutch ANWB drivers association.

Ontwerpen en ontwikkelen van een datawarehouse voor de opslag van data uit Exact Next administraties van de verschillende tour-operator dochters. Rapporten omvatten P&L en balans gecombineerd met boeking informatie uit de diverse boeking systemen. De Excel sheets worden automatisch geformatteerd met Vba. Daarnaast een Olap cubus ontwikkelt voor multidimensionale analyses op basis van SSAS met divers SSRS en PowerPivot rapportages. Verschillende ETL

3 / 6 versie: mei 2023

Page 4: Profiel - fkootstra.nl Freek Kootstra v20151101...  · Web viewRuim 15 jaar werkzaam in de ICT. Vooral ontwikkelen van administratieve software. Mijn interesse gaat uit naar software-architectuur

Curriculum Vitae Freek Kootstra

processen verzorgen de import van de data in het datawarehouse opgezet volgens Kimball.

Gebruikte software: VisualStudio2008/SqlServer2008R2 64bitExcel2007, SSRS, SSAS

Operating systeem : Windows 2008R2 Server

10/2008 – 12/2012 SqlServer developerNidera Trading Company

Het opzetten en implementeren van een DataWarehouse ter vervanging van het huidige rapportage systeem. Gebruik wordt gemaakt van Analysis en Reporting Server. De import van data geschiedt uit een AS400 met daarin het trading systeem. Tijdens de ontwikkeling onderhouden en corrigeren van de huidige rapportages gebaseerd op T-Sql views naar de AS400. Het verzamelen en ontsluiten van supply en demand gegevens voor verhandelde producten zoals granen en oliën vanaf het internet ter ondersteuning van de traders. ETL import van data uit diverse bronsystemen en internet.

Gebruikte software: VisualStudio2005/SqlServer2005SSRS, SSIS, SSAS, Excel2007

Operating systeem : Windows XP, AS400

03/2008 – 03/2009 Software engineer, ArchitectDTE-ICT

Het ontwikkelen van een basis middle-tier framework voor generieke communicatie tussen front- en back-office systemen. Het betreft een grotendeels abstracte structuur die met behulp van reflectie specifieke data-adapters activeert en via onder andere remoting aan andere software ter beschikking stelt. Een laag van specifieke service implementaties verzorgt de vertaling naar het onderliggende data-systeem en vice versa.

Gebruikte software: VisualStudio2008/.NET framework 3.5 – 4.5Operating systeem : Windows XP

03/2008 – 03/2009 Software engineer, ArchitectDTE-ICT

Het opzetten en inrichten van een ontwikkel-omgeving voor de developers van DTE-ICT met een Subversion versie-beheer server, Apache webserver, SQLServer2005 developer server en VirtualPC’s met diverse voorgeinstalleerde ontwikkel-omgevingen.

Gebruikte software:Subversion/Apache/SQLServerOperating systeem : Windows XP/Windows2003 Server

04/2007 – 03/2008 Software engineer, DeveloperExact Software Delft

Het ontwikkelen van Custom Solutions bij Exact EMEA, de internationale divisie van Exact. De werkzaamheden betreffen het ontwikkelen van aanpassingen en uitbreidingen van Exact Globe Enterprise. Dit voor grote internationale bedrijven die specifieke extra of afwijkende functionaliteit nodig hebben voor hun financiële administratie. Daarnaast ook modules voor het exporteren/importeren van en naar andere software pakketten. De projecten variëren van kleine oplossingen zoals een XML-export tot grote projecten met uitgebreide veranderingen van het standaard pakket. De oplossingen worden gebouwd door een klein team bestaande uit een designer, developer en tester in nauwe samenwerking met de klant.

Gebruikte software: VB6.0 / SQLServer2000/Exact Globe EnterpriseOperating systeem : Windows 2003 Server

4 / 6 versie: mei 2023

Page 5: Profiel - fkootstra.nl Freek Kootstra v20151101...  · Web viewRuim 15 jaar werkzaam in de ICT. Vooral ontwikkelen van administratieve software. Mijn interesse gaat uit naar software-architectuur

Curriculum Vitae Freek Kootstra

01/2001 – 03/2007 Software engineer, Developer + DesignerInfospaceMobile, Papendrecht

Diverse projecten uitgevoerd, vanaf 2003 met .Net.In omgekeerd chronologische volgorde:

- Met C# /ASP.Net Internet proxy voor MMS-bericht verkeer. De proxy vertaalt het interne XML-formaat naar het door klanten gehanteerde formaat of standaard MM3 / MM7 formaat. Daarnaast zet de proxy ook de verbinding met de server van de klant op met zonodig authenticatie en encryptie. De proxy is generiek opgezet en kan voor elke verbinding worden ingezet.

- Met C#, ASP.Net, SQLServer 2000, XML-server: Interfacing van het SMS/MMS platform met het JdEdwards boekhoudsysteem. Naast import-routines voor het legacy Clipper-systeem ook een platform-onafhankelijke import-API op basis van ASP.NET en een calculatie-module in C#.NET .

- Met C#, ASP.Net: Web-interface voor het invoeren, configureren, activeren en monitoren van SMS en MMS-bulkverzendingen. De Web-interface is beveiligd en de invoer en andere acties vanuit de interface worden op verschillende niveau's gecontroleerd zowel voor als tijdens de verzendingen.

- Met VisualBasic.Net: Het ontwikkelen van een SQLServer-connectie module als onderdeel van een failover-script. Deze module stelt andere .NET en niet-.NET programma's in staat om hun verbinding automatisch over te zetten naar de Standby-SQLServer in geval van onderhoud of storing van de Productie-SQLServer.

- Met SQL Server 2000: Het beheren van de SQLServer2000 database. Periodiek onderhoud aan de databases, het maken van back-up’s, uitvoeren en controleren van Jobs. Tevens het schrijven van ad-hoc SQL-queries voor verzoeken van gegevens uit de database en voor het vullen en aanpassen van data in tabellen.

- Met MS-Word2000, VB6.0, ASP2.0, SQL Server2000: Het ontwerpen, ontwikkelen, implementeren en beheren van een database met transactie-gegevens van het SMS-platform voor statistische doeleinden en facturering. De database wordt benaderd door een VisualBasic6 applicatie van waaruit facturen naar MS-Word worden verzonden. Tevens zijn er diverse Web-applicaties maarmee statistische gegevens kunnen worden geraadpleegd. Deze Web-pagina's zijn ook beschikbaar voor klanten via een beveiligdeSSL-connectie. Zowel de VisualBasic-applicatie als de Web-interface benaderen een Back-End van Stored Procedures geschreven in TransactSQL. Daarnaast wordt gebruik gemaakt van XML-output uit de SQLServer en XSL-stylesheets. De statistische gegevens kunnen worden gepresenteerd als tabellen of grafieken met behulp van ChartFX. De werkzaamheden aan het hart van dit systeem zijn afgerond in september 2002. Dit is later omgebouwd naar DotNet voor interfacing met JdEdwards.

- Met VB 6.0: ontwikkelen en implementeren van diverse SMS-diensten als onderdeel van het standaard-pakket van SMS-diensten zoals geleverd door Infospace aan de mobiele telefonie-operators. Deze applicaties verzorgen onder andere het opvragen van file-informatie, beursfonds-koersen, uitgaansgelegenheden en vluchtinformatie. Deze applicaties wisselen sterk in complexiteit.

10/1999 – 12/2000 Software engineer, HelpdeskWitchcraft IT Services, Rotterdam

Voor een klein Rotterdams IT bedrijf voor klanten ontwikkelen van o.a. Microsoft Office-macro’s en Internet/Intranet applicaties. Daarnaast gedurende ruim een half jaar als helpdesk-medewerker gedetacheerd bij de Rotterdamse bibliotheek voor IT-support

10/1998 – 09/1999 Junior programmeurHANDS B.V., Rotterdam

Gedetacheerd bij de ANWB (ACDIS) voor het mee ontwikkelen van een Account-management-systeem dat via een Intranet-applicatie ook door de Helpdesk geraadpleegd moest kunnen worden.

5 / 6 versie: mei 2023

Page 6: Profiel - fkootstra.nl Freek Kootstra v20151101...  · Web viewRuim 15 jaar werkzaam in de ICT. Vooral ontwikkelen van administratieve software. Mijn interesse gaat uit naar software-architectuur

Curriculum Vitae Freek Kootstra

Daarnaast het zelfstandig ontwikkelen van Microsoft Acces macro’s en het schrijven van batch-import SQL-scripts voor SQLServer 6.5

6 / 6 versie: mei 2023